DESCRIPTION


The project seeks a vendor to deliver a comprehensive jail management system, including software and ongoing maintenance support services for a Maryland facility. This new system should enhance data collection and analysis, enabling insights into inmate behavior, program participation, and individualized rehabilitation needs. The goal is to support targeted rehabilitation initiatives and data-based decision-making to help reduce recidivism and facilitate successful reintegration of inmates upon release.

The solution must offer robust tools for tracking and evaluating rehabilitation efforts, identifying trends related to inmate needs, operational challenges, and security concerns, ultimately contributing to strategic planning and operational efficiency. Enhanced transparency is required through advanced reporting mechanisms to support regulatory compliance, ensure accountability, and enable continuous improvements in inmate and facility management. Critical system requirements include integration with enterprise authentication methods and removal of Java dependencies, as well as robust security and privacy measures, particularly for the protection of controlled information such as PII, PHI, and CJI.

A non-mandatory pre-bid meeting is scheduled for July 30, 2026. Vendors are required to submit all questions by August 13, 2026.
